About Central Venous Catheter Kit

A central venous catheter, also called a central line, is a long, thin, flexible tube used to give medicines, fluids, nutrients, or blood products over a long period of time, usually several weeks or more. A catheter is often inserted in the arm or chest through the skin into a large vein.

Carefully & geometrically designed soft and conical tip of catheter ensures safe and easy insertion offering good tissue and blood tolerance thus reduces the risk of blood clotting & intra vascular pain. Exceptionally bio-compatible PU material which by property is stiff & non-kinking at room temperature but softens at body temperature thus ensures correct placement of catheter. Soft & flexible tip of guide wire with excellent stiffness offers good torque which helps in easy insertion and prevents vessel perforation. Clear and transparent radio-opaque material of lumen with definite marking and color coding ensures accurate positioning and minimum vessel damage.
